The Riddler : BIO

Energetic, dynamic, versatile, and passionate are just a few words used to describe DJ Rich aka "The Riddler". Even before coming to New York City in 1995, The Riddler was making moves to take him to new levels in his career. Starting in the music industry as a DJ, The Riddler's record bag was filled with early Electro, Chicago House and Hip-Hop records. His favorite DJ's at this time were, and still are, considered legends; Bad Boy Bill, Julian "Jumpin' Perez", Cash Money, and DJ Aladdin. "I loved the way they all would cut, scratch, transform, and do tricks, but Bad Boy Bill would do all of that combined with house tracks all while mixing like a mad man! They gave me inspiration to do it all."

Originally born and raised in Chicago, DJ Rich's musical trek began in Texas. While living in the Lone Star State, he held club residencies in Houston, Austin, and San Antonio every week, and even hosted radio mixshows in each market at the same time (104 KRBE, 98.7 KHFI, and 102.7 KTFM). During November of 1995, DJ Rich moved from Texas to New York City, landing a job with the prestigious Tommy Boy Records. Shortly thereafter, Rich took to the New York Radio Airwaves on Z100 (WHTZ). With his Saturday night mix of Dance and Hip-Hop, DJ Rich kept a balanced attack to excite the Big Apples Saturday night listeners. Voted Hotmixer of the year at the Dirty Dozen Awards during the 2000 Winter Music Conference, in addition to becoming 1999 S.I.N Mixshow DJ of the Year, all led to more opportunities in the radio industry.

The Riddler has had some successful compilations such as MTV's The Grind (Tommy Boy), Planet Dance (Tommy Boy), Club Series Vol. 4(SHR/UC), Club Series Vol. 5(SHR/UC). Currently, His new CD - DANCE MIX NYC(Tommy Boy) is a collection of current KTU Hits such as Jessica Folker, Tamia, Da Buzz, P2000, Digital Allies, Melanie C., Amber and others. Furthermore, The Riddler has produced and remixed some successful projects like the Gold Selling Single "Jock Jam Mega Mix", and most recently Eden's Crush "Love this way" and "Get over yourself" on the Totally Dance compilation (Arista), as well as Melanie C "Never be the same again". 103.5 (WKTU) is "The Riddler's" next radio show, showcasing his talent next to an All-star DJ lineup including the likes of MTV's DJ Skribble, Grammy Award Winning David Morales, Hex Hector, Johnny Vicious, and Armand Van Helden. A man of many hats, DJ Rich "The Riddler" is ready to show us how they play it during WKTU's "Mix at 6" ,"RSL" and now Saturday Nights for the KTU Hitfactory Level 2.
